What is the HEX Code and RGB Value for the Merlot Magic Color?

The Merlot Magic color is represented by the HEX code #b64055, and its RGB equivalent is RGB(182, 64, 85). These values are widely used in web design and digital media to ensure accurate color representation across different platforms.

How is Merlot Magic color described in the HSL model?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) model, Merlot Magic is represented by a hue of 349°, saturation of 48%, and lightness of 48%. This model is primarily used in graphic design software to modify the lightness or color richness, helping designers achieve the perfect balance of brightness and intensity for their projects.

How does Merlot Magic behave in the HSV model?

In the HSV model, Merlot Magic color is represented by hue 349°, saturation 65%, and value 71%.

What is the difference between shades and tones of Merlot Magic?

Shades of Merlot Magic are created by adding black to the base color, resulting in a darker appearance, whereas tones are achieved by adding gray, making the color more muted.
